  • BlackBerry Smartphones Blackberry 8330 - E-mail Delete discounts on Blackberry and computer at home

    I currently have a Blackberry 8330, v4.5.0.186 (Platform 3.4.0.59).

    I used to be asked to delete e-mails power off my blackberry and Windows Mail from my computer at home.  I think that after the update to Blackberry, this option was no longer available, which forces me to read emails on my Blackberry, then having to remove them from my home computer.

    Does anyone know of a way I can restore this feature on my Blackberry?

    Thanks in advance.

    When you say "update BlackBerry' say you you updated the software or you updated the device from an older device?

    When you open an email, scroll upward in the headers.  Next to "Receipt using" lists the e-mail address, or should I say unknown?

    If it says 'unknown', you simply return your service books.

    Go to the icon on your device which indicates the configuration of e-mail (manage Internet Email on some devices) and go to the configuration of your e-mail.  There is an option to "return the directories of service."

    If it shows your email address then it is not bad to go and return service even when directories but then you will need to:

    Go to Messages > Options > email reconciliation.

    Choose the Message Service in question (there may be multiple ones if you have more than one e-mail address set up on top of the unit.

    Then change ' remove the ' to 'ask '.

    This is how to update an operating system

    Manual device OS upgrade instructions:

    1. start by searching for your operator and the system operating file that you want to use.

    http://NA.BlackBerry.com/eng/support/downloads/download_sites.jsp

    2. make a backup of your device first, using Desktop Manager > backup. Close at the end Office Manager and disconnect it from BlackBerry. Get DM here http://us.blackberry.com/apps-software/desktop/

    3. download the OS files to the PC then install on the PC by running (double click) the downloaded file.

    4. go into c:\program files Research in motion\apploader and delete the file named "vendor.xml."

    5. This step is not necessary unless there is a problem on the next steps. Use BBSAK from BBSAK.org and wipe the device (after doing a full backup), then after you get the 507 error (no OS installed) then proceed to step 6

    6 remove the internet connection for PC and reboot the PC.

    7. plug the BlackBerry and double-click on "Loader.exe." It is located in the same place as the above vendor.xml file was in.

    8. If you did step 5, restoration of the back upward. Follow this KB if necessary http://www.blackberry.com/btsc/KB10339

    Take advantage of the new operating system.
